Connect to your opportunity

Are you a strategic thinker with a passion for delivering impactful client engagement programmes? This is an exciting opportunity to join a dynamic and collaborative team, where you will play a key role in shaping and delivering role-based marketing strategies for C-Suite executives. By fostering long-term relationships and creating tailored client experiences, you will help drive measurable business outcomes and make a real impact.

As a Manager, you will take ownership of a C-Suite role-based engagement programme, managing end-to-end. This role requires exceptional organisational skills, the 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ously, and a strategic mindset to deliver innovative, client-focused marketing initiatives.

Key responsibilities:

  • Lead the delivery of a C-Suite role-based engagement programme ensuring clear project planning, defined milestones, and timely execution
  • Build and manage relationships with senior stakeholders across the business, advocating for a new approach to relationship building and driving behavioural change among client relationship owners (Partner level)
  • Oversee the delivery of a masterclass for senior relationship owners, equipping them with the tools and insights needed to strengthen C-Suite relationships
  • Work closely with internal teams across the Clients and Markets function, including client relationship managers, our Executive Boardroom Programme team, and marketing leads, to ensure a seamless and integrated client experience
  • Identify gaps in role-specific content and collaborate with subject matter experts to create tailored insights, thought leadership, and experiences for clients
  • Design and deliver innovative client labs, events, and experiences aligned with the role-based engagement strategy
  • Working with your Senior Manager, conduct internal deep discovery interviews for selected clients with internal stakeholders, to gather insights on key clients, using this information to create personalised engagement plans and tailored touchpoints
  • Collaborate with other marketing and sponsorship teams across the firm to integrate relevant events, sponsorship opportunities, and content into client engagement plans
  • Track, measure and report on the effectiveness of engagement plans, providing actionable insights to senior leadership and supporting the Marketing Director and Senior Manager in executive-level reporting for Role-Based marketing

**Personal independence **

Regulation and controls are standard practice in our industry and Deloitte is no exception. These controls provide important legal protection for both you and the firm. We are subject to a number of audit regulations, one of which requires that certain colleagues abide by specific personal independence constraints (e.g., in relation to any financial interests and employment relationships). This can mean that you and your "Immediate Family Members" are not permitted to hold certain financial interests (shares, funds, bonds etc.) with audit clients of the firm, and also prohibitions on certain employment relationships (e.g., you are not permitted to hold a secondary employment role with SEC audit clients of the firm whilst being employed by the firm). The recruitment team will provide further detail as you progress through the recruitment process or you can contact the Independence team upon request.
